The aim of this study is to evaluate clinically and radio-graphically the efficiency of "Tent- Pole "grafting technique for reconstruction of anterior or posterior mandibular ridge defects using synthetic bone graft and Platelet Rich Fibrin (PRF) membrane.
Various techniques have been described for the reconstruction of large vertical defects before implant placement . In this study we assessed the efficacy of tenting the periosteum and soft tissue matrix with titanium screws maintaining a space for the graft material in order to augment large vertical defects of mandibular ridge (anterior or posterior region) using data from 12 patients . After 6 months we assessed the increase in bone height and density.

Ten milliliters of whole venous blood will be collected in sterile glass test tubes without anticoagulant. Then the test tubes will be placed in a table centrifuge machine at 3000 revolutions per minute (rpm) for 10 minutes.After separation of PRF, the membrane is prepared compression device. |

This is a single-arm trial of 12 patients with mandibular large vertical defects treated using synthetic bone graft around titanium screws to tent out the soft tissue matrix.
